This is a secret little site surrounded by Prairie. Grasslands and succulent deciduous trees. There's about six for mal sites with a level gravel spot. Each site can accommodate two vehicles above 33 ft long. It has a vaulted bathroom which is spotlessly clean. There is a picnic table and a fire ring with a gray at each site. The picnic tables are extended for easy wheelchair access. There are loads of birds. The best site is by the river that has the shade of a tree. The others don't have much shade. You do hear the highway and the trains going by. Cell service is about 1/3 bar. When we were camping in middle of June there was only one other caper and the best site next to the tree. There is also boat access here to the river. - DL M

Bratten Fishing Access Site is conveniently located near the small community of Greycliff, Montana. The general address is listed as Bratten, Greycliff, MT 59033, USA. This site is situated on the banks of the Yellowstone River, just off of Interstate 90. The access is straightforward, making it an easy and quick stop for travelers. Directions often specify taking I-90 Exit 392 to North Frontage Road, and then traveling west for about 4.5 miles to reach the site.

The accessibility is a major plus. On-site parking is available, with a review noting that the level, gravel spots can accommodate two vehicles up to 33 feet long. This makes it suitable for a variety of setups, from tent campers to those with RVs and trailers. The boat access to the river is a key feature for anglers and floaters, but it's important to note that the boat ramp is gravel. While the site is close to the highway and a train line, which means you can hear some traffic noise, the overall convenience of its location makes it a worthwhile trade-off for many campers.
